Output d86921e174b6ddaf0fc89159f2091a97dc8c60c3780293163c0ef3b01fa248b7:0

value
139886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be32b17d1a3435821ca3a9533692a25c42d22f9 OP_EQUAL
address
3JpURMAXAzVVJEkmEPyzqQs3mHpE8d1nxU
transaction
d86921e174b6ddaf0fc89159f2091a97dc8c60c3780293163c0ef3b01fa248b7
spent
true